Intended Use

CORIOGRAPH Pre-Op Planning and Modeling Services are intended to provide preoperative planning for surgical procedures based on patient imaging, provided that anatomic landmarks necessary for generating the plan are identifiable on patient imaging scans.

Technology

The device includes CORIOGRAPH Hip Pre-Op Plan and CORIOGRAPH Modeler modules that utilize patient imaging scans, primarily CT for hips, to generate patient-specific bone models and preoperative surgical plans. It combines these plans with implant positioning simulations. Plan generation involves medical personnel and software-based modeling, which is viewed and editable via the CORIOGRAPH Modeler software.

Performance

Verification and validation testing demonstrated safety and effectiveness. Summative usability testing showed surgeons could safely and effectively use the device in simulated conditions. Kinematic models and activities of daily living included are clinically relevant. All design inputs were met without raising safety or effectiveness concerns.
